Skype application for tv

December 18, 2006 - 9:36 AM | Voip

The Skype Voip System has been launched to offers free calls online or to dial low-cost calls to external landline and mobile phone numbers using SkypeOut.

Skype is a perfect tool to stay in touch with friends and family.

Many telecommunications operators hope that in the next future the television will converge with internet but the future is just here because With increase demand for online video, Janus Friis and Niklas Zennastrom have decided to launch Skype for television.

Janus Friis said:“At the time we launched Skype, broadband capacity was extremely ripe for communication,” Mr Friis recalls. “Now, three years later, it’s the same thing for video: you can do TV over the internet in a really good way. TV is a huge medium – that’s something we’d like to be a part of.”

Click to call in Google Maps

November 17, 2006 - 9:50PM | News

Last week google announced a new upgrade for its google maps.

If you want to calls an restaurant or an store (in the US), google maps allows to make this.

the search results display a call link next to the phone number of the business

Search a business, see the map where they're located, search results display a call find a link with listed phone number.

Now, enter your phone number (for example cell phone number) and click to Connect For Free.

Google calls the number and automatically connects you to the number that you want to call.

All you have to do now, to enter in google maps. to verify.

The google blog says that they will flip the bill for local and long distance charges (not including airtime charges).

VoIP ConCall: Q&A with Ed Wadbrook, Microsoft – Part 1

November 5, 2006 - 11:12AM

VoIP News: Let’s talk about Microsoft's Unified Communication Strategy and look at, if you can, where you are headed with those.

Ed Wadbrook: In the fall of last year we made a series of presentations to the Senior Leadership Team [at Microsoft] and got approval for our business plan. What that did, was it created a number of activities. Activity #1: we completed an acquisition over in Europe of a company called Mediastreams, which had built a very robust first-generation UC product. It's software-based, integrated into applications, and leverages direct PSTN connectivity.

Vonage and Motorola have Unveiled a new co-branded VoIP adapter with router

October 24, 2006 - 3:00AM

Vonage and Motorola announced a new co-branded VoIP adapter with router, the Motorola VT2142.

The voip hardware has integrated 2 Vonage lines telephone adapter that they will come used for the Vonage voip service.

“As Vonage always seeks to offer a variety of hardware choices, we are pleased to offer Motorola's new product for our less expensive, flat-rate, full-featured calling plans. Motorola is a proven partner and we are happy to add another one of its devices to our portfolio,” said Vonage Network, Inc.’s senior vice president of engineering, Daniel Smires, in a statement.

The hardware installation is very simple: The router connect on your phone and link it to your broadband line.

Motorola VT2142 is currently selling for $49,99 online, to add $29.99 activation fee and a $9.95 shipping fee.
